1. Comprehending Paver Basics
Pavers are specific units-- normally concrete, block, or natural stone-- stocked interlacing patterns over a compacted base. Unlike poured concrete, pavers bend a little, resisting cracking throughout Florida's frequent temperature level swings and heavy rainfall. Because each rock is separate, fixings typically suggest popping out a solitary damaged device rather than jack-hammering a whole slab.

Secret advantages:

Curb allure: Crisp joints and unlimited shade blends fit modern, Mediterranean, or historic style.

Longevity: High-quality pavers flaunt compressive strengths as much as 8,000 psi-- much above common driveway lots.

Easy fixes: Individual substitutes fast and economical.

Leaks in the structure options: Permeable pavers reduce storm-water runoff, a large plus in seaside St Johns County.

5. The Installation Process, Step by Step.
Understanding the workflow assists you evaluate whether your picked team is cutting edges.

Excavation & Base Prep.

Remove sod/soil 7-- 9 inches deep (much deeper for driveways).

Compact sub-base with a plate compactor.

Include 4-- 6 inches of crushed rock, compacting in 2-inch lifts for security.

Edge Restraints.

Concrete or PVC restrictions protect against side activity.

Secured with 12-inch spikes every 12-- 18 inches.

Screeded Sand Layer.

One inch of concrete sand, leveled with steel pipelines and a screed board.

Never ever stroll on screeded sand; it interrupts qualities.

Laying Pavers.

Start at a 90-degree edge.

Maintain consistent joint spacing (⅛-- 1/4 inch).

Cut edge items with a damp saw for tight fits.

Compaction & Joint Sand.

Run a vibratory plate compactor with a rubber floor covering to "seat" pavers.

Move polymeric sand right into joints; water gently to trigger binding representatives.

Sealing (Optional).

Adds sheen, enhances color, and blocks discolorations.

Wait 48 hours after polymeric sand treatments prior to using sealant.

6. Maintenance Tips for Lasting Beauty.
Annual Cleaning: A low-pressure rinse plus a mild degreaser lifts algae and bbq oil.

Weed Control: Polymeric sand lowers growing; spot-treat strays with white vinegar.

Re-Sealing: Driveways see heavy wear-- reapply sealer every three to 5 years.

Joint Touch-Ups: If sand deteriorates, top it off to maintain joints tight and stop ant swarms.

9. Warning That Signal "Keep Searching".
A quote considerably less than three others (" low-ball then upsell" technique).

Vague timeline commitments (" we'll press you in when we can").

No physical workplace address or only a cell number.

Cash-only demands without any official invoice.

Reluctance to include legal fines for schedule overruns.
